East Otterburn Farm is a five-bedroom, 232 sq m stone-built country home occupying a prominent position in the village of Otterburn. The property has two floors of accommodation, with a reception hall providing access to principal reception rooms. The sitting room features a substantial inglenook fireplace with multi-fuel burner, while the dining room has a character fireplace and built-in storage. A breakfaasting kitchen with a range-style cooker, feature inglenook fireplace, and generous worktop space forms the heart of the home. A separate pantry and utility room provide additional storage and convenience. Four double bedrooms, each with an en-suite shower room, and a principal bedroom with a free-standing bath and valley views make up the first-floor accommodation. A ground-floor home office with an en-suite shower room and utility room also provides flexibility for guests or multi-generational living. The property has a large plot of 0.4 of an acre, with attractive gardens, a enclosed courtyard, two stables, a tack room, a log store, a hay shed, and substantial off-street parking. A traditional stone storage barn providing additional versatility is also features.
